Are you suffering with an urgent eye problem? Red Eyes, flashes, floaters or any other recent eye problem? The Minor Eye Condition Service can offer you an appointment at your local opticians.
Symptoms that can be seen under the service include:
• Red eye or eyelids
• Dry eye, or gritty and uncomfortable eyes
• Irritation and inflammation of the eye
• Significant recent sticky discharge from the eye or watery eye
• Recently occurring flashes or floaters
• In-growing eyelashes
• Recent and sudden loss of vision
• Foreign body in the eye
